How they compare

Netherlands currently reports 187.86 billion constant LCU against 149.01 billion constant LCU in Peru, a difference of 38.85 billion constant LCU.

That makes Netherlands's figure about 1.3 times Peru's.

Across all 57 years both countries report, Netherlands has been ahead every year.

Globally, Netherlands ranks 85th and Peru ranks 88th of 167 countries.

Gross fixed capital formation includes acquisitions less disposals of fixed assets during the accounting period, including certain specified expenditures on services that add to the value of non-produced assets. This indicator is expressed in constant prices, meaning the series has been adjusted to account for price changes over time. The reference year for this adjustment varies by country. This series is expressed in local currency units.
